Memo — Insurance Renewal Heads-Up

Team, quick note before the Fallowmere policy renews next month. Our broker at Quillstone & Harrow flagged a premium bump tied to last year's warehouse claim, but we've pushed back and expect something closer to flat. Sales leads: please don't commit to coverage terms with clients until the renewal is signed. If prospects ask, say terms are under review. The reason this matters commercially is below.

confidential, kagep-kahof: Druokax Systems plans to lower the Ulaath list price by 53 percent in March.

## Deployment Notes: Integration Test Flakiness

Reviewers should be aware that the Ledgerline payments service has a known class of flaky integration tests caused by timing sensitivity in the settlement mock. We quarantine these behind a retry harness rather than skipping them, so a red build may still indicate a real regression — please check whether failures reproduce across all three retries before approving. To reproduce the CI environment locally, start the test harness with the following configuration values.

service settings:
[casax]
port = 6379
team = rusir
host = casax.zemvarhq.corp
region = outer-4
access_code = ac_9808ce
timeout_ms = 1500

Onboarding: fan-out backpressure (Hollowpine Notify)

Fan-out workers pull from the Bramblequeue topic. If consumer lag exceeds 30s, the gate throttles producers — don't approve PRs that bypass the gate. Dead letters go to the overflow bucket, replayed hourly. Reviewers need read access to the throttle dashboard; the credentials vault unlocks with the recovery passphrase below.

vault phrase of bagaf-kajeg = jorath-feniel-briir-siliel-ralix

### v2.8.0 — Renamed setting

Quick one for release: the Shipchirp bot's `BOT_HOOK` setting is now `DEPLOY_ANNOUNCE_CHANNEL` — same behavior, clearer name. Old name still works until v3.0, but you'll get a startup warning. The bot also needs its chat-gateway secret in the env file, added on the next line.

sealed setting: ARCHIVE_KEY3=8d0